The permission container projects like All-Projects, or Kernel-Projects on 
android should be hidden by default from the host index. These aren't really 
interesting for someone looking at source code.

There are times that an admin wants to browse these, so we should still make 
them available, but maybe collapse them under an expand out toggle, or move 
them to a second page with a link shown at the bottom of the main project 
listing.

Possibilities:
-Hide repos where HEAD points to refs/meta/config
-Hide repos that contain only refs/meta/config
-Hide repos that contain no branches or tags
(All of these are straightforwardly implemented in DefaultAccess or other 
GitilesAccess implementation.)
